THEATRE by the Lake has appointed Liz Stevenson as its new artistic director.

Liz - who takes over from Conrad Lynch who stepped down from the Keswick theatre last September - is currently a freelance director and artistic director of Chorley-based theatre company, Junction 8.

After training on the Theatre Directing MFA at Birkbeck College, she has directed plays for York Theatre Royal and Manchester’s Royal Exchange, and as TBTL’s associate director, she directed its 2017’s Christmas show The Secret Garden.

Liz said she was delighted to have been appointed: “It’s an honour to be invited to lead the theatre’s artistic vision at this exciting time, making inspirational theatre for, with and about Cumbrian communities, and building on the theatre’s reputation for making bold and ambitious work.”

Liz steps into the spotlight in May and will work with the TBTL team planning her first season for 2020.
